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2024 | 5.19B | -649.68M | +88.87% |
Dec 31, 2023 | 5.84B | 81.35M | +101.41% |
Dec 31, 2022 | 5.76B | 418.82M | +107.85% |
Dec 31, 2021 | 5.34B | 1.28B | +131.62% |
Dec 31, 2020 | 4.05B | -1.31B | +75.62% |
Dec 31, 2019 | 5.36B | -355.09M | +93.79% |
Dec 31, 2018 | 5.72B | 69.65M | +101.23% |
Dec 31, 2017 | 5.65B | -349.23M | +94.18% |
Dec 31, 2016 | 6.00B | ― | ― |